Key Considerations For Furnace Room Doors

Safety And Compliance

Door selection should prioritize safety and code compliance. Look for doors that meet local fire and building regulations for rooms containing fuel-burning appliances. A self-closing mechanism and proper weatherstripping help contain heat, reduce drafts, and minimize fire spread risks. Regularly verify that CO detectors and adequate ventilation remain functional near the furnace room entrance. Always consult a licensed professional to ensure doors and hardware meet regional requirements.

Materials And Durability

Material choice affects durability, moisture resistance, and maintenance. Steel doors offer strength and humidity resilience, while fire-rated composite options blend safety with design flexibility. Wood doors deliver warmth and customization but require sealing against humidity and potential warping in basements. A smart approach combines fire-rated construction with a finish appropriate for damp environments, extending service life while preserving aesthetics.

Ventilation And Access

Ventilation is essential to prevent heat buildup and maintain air quality. Louvered panels or doors with discreet vents can improve airflow without exposing the equipment to dust. Ensure the opening remains easy to access for routine maintenance, filter changes, and emergency shutoffs. For ventilation-focused designs, pair vented doors with clean, moisture-resistant interior surfaces to minimize condensation.

Insulation And Air Sealing

Proper insulation reduces energy loss and prevents cold drafts from entering living spaces. Use doors with tight seals or add weatherstripping along the frame. Consider insulating cores or fire-rated cores in metal or composite doors for enhanced performance. Have the gap around the door correctly adjusted to maintain security and prevent heat exchange.

Hardware And Security

Hardware should support frequent use and protect against accidental openings. Self-closing hinges, robust trims, and appropriate handles improve safety and ease of operation. If the door locks, choose weatherproof hardware and consider tamper-resistant finishes. Magnetic catches or floor-mounted closers can keep doors securely in place when the furnace is not in active use.

Door Design Ideas

Fire-Rated Steel Door With Concealed Hinges

A fire-rated steel door delivers durability and security while maintaining a modern look. Concealed hinges provide a clean exterior profile, suitable for contemporary basements or utility corridors. Pair with weatherstripping and a self-closing mechanism to meet safety standards and minimize drafts.

Warm Wood Panel Door With Moisture-Resistant Finish

Wood adds character to the home but requires finishes designed for humidity. Choose tropical or engineered hardwoods with water-repellent coatings and vinyl or aluminum trim that resist moisture. This option works well in houses where the furnace room is adjacent to living spaces, offering a classic aesthetic.

Barn-Style Sliding Door For Space Efficiency

Sliding doors save floor space and can conceal a utility area behind a stylish façade. Use track hardware rated for doors of the door’s weight and lifecycle. Wood or wood-veneered panels with a matte or satin finish complement rustic or traditional interiors while keeping the furnace area accessible.

Ventilated Louvers For Airflow

Louvered doors provide passive ventilation, reducing heat buildup and maintaining airflow. Use moisture-resistant louvers made of metal or coated wood. This option suits rooms where airflow is a priority, but ensure the design preserves adequate dust protection and privacy for storage needs.

Frosted Glass Panels For Light And Visibility

Frosted glass or glass-ceramic panels let light pass into dim utility spaces while preserving privacy. Use fire-rated glass to meet safety standards and pair with metal or solid wood frames for durability. This design blends practicality with a contemporary look in open-plan homes.

Half-Height Or Access Panel Doors

Half-height doors combine concealment with easy access for routine checks. An access panel at the lower portion allows quick interaction with valves or filters without fully opening the door to the entire room. Finish the upper portion to match adjacent walls for a cohesive appearance.

Decorative Panels Or Custom Inlays

Personalize a door with decorative panels, carved inlays, or color-matched finishes. This approach lets homeowners reflect style themes from surrounding rooms while maintaining safety and accessibility. Ensure the design remains practical for cleaning and maintenance in a utility area.

Finishes And Customization

Color And Finish Options

Choose finishes that complement the home’s interior palette. Neutral tones like whites, grays, or charcoal offer timeless compatibility, while deeper hues can create contrast against light walls. For metal doors, powder-coated finishes resist fingerprints and corrosion in humid spaces. Always apply moisture-resistant primers or sealants to prolong life in basements.

Decorative Panels And Engraving

Decorative panels, raised or flat, can elevate a furnace door’s appearance. Consider simple profiling, subtle grain patterns, or geometric motifs that echo interior trim. Engraving or embossing should be corrosion-resistant and easy to clean in a maintenance-heavy environment.

Safety Labeling And Signage

Place safety labels near the door to remind occupants of gas appliances, CO detector locations, and emergency shutoffs. Use durable, legible signs that resist humidity and cleaning agents. Clear labeling improves quick recognition during routine maintenance or emergencies.

Installation And Budgeting

Measuring The Opening For A Replacement Door

Accurate measurements prevent gaps and ensure a proper seal. Measure height, width, and the rough opening width; account for hinge placement, swing direction, and floor clearance. If possible, bring the old door to the hardware store to compare thickness and core construction before purchasing.

Code Requirements And Permits

Regional codes govern fire-resistance ratings, self-closing hardware, and ventilation considerations for furnace rooms. Homeowners should verify requirements with local building departments, especially when refitting an exterior-facing or shared wall. Hiring a licensed contractor helps ensure compliance and safe installation.

Budgeting And Cost Ranges

Door costs vary by material, finish, and hardware. A basic interior door can cost a few hundred dollars, while fire-rated steel or composite options may range from $500 to $1,500 or more, plus installation. Include hardware, weatherstripping, and potential framing adjustments in the budget. For high-end designs with custom panels or frosted glass, plan a larger investment.

DIY Vs Professional Installation

Simple doors may be suitable for DIY installation, but furnace room doors often require precise alignment, fire-rating compliance, and proper hardware. A professional installer reduces the risk of air leaks, misalignment, and code violations. For safety-critical rooms, professional installation is generally recommended.

Maintenance And Long-Term Care

Regular checks on seals, hinges, and weatherstripping help maintain performance. Clean surfaces with mild cleaners, avoid harsh chemicals that could degrade finishes, and reapply protective coatings as needed. Inspect for moisture damage, rust on metal parts, and ensure the door still closes softly and fully.

Smart And Safety Upgrades

Smart Detectors And Enhanced Sealing

Consider integrating smart CO detectors and humidity sensors near the furnace room door. These devices can alert homeowners to unusual conditions while the door remains closed. Enhanced sealing reduces drafts and improves energy efficiency.

Sealing For Energy Efficiency

Weatherstripping tailored to the door type minimizes air leakage. Magnetic seals or brush-type weatherstrips are effective options for steel and fiberglass doors, while foam seals work well with wood frames. Proper installation is essential for optimal performance.

Ongoing Safety Checks

Schedule periodic inspections of the furnace room door assembly, including the self-closing mechanism and hinge wear. Testing CO detectors and ensuring emergency shutoffs are accessible improves overall safety. A proactive maintenance plan helps prevent costly repairs and safety incidents.
